Photovoltaic glass substrates Employed in photo voltaic cells usually incorporate extremely-slender glass, surface area-coated glass, and very low-iron (additional-apparent) glass. According to their Homes and production solutions, photovoltaic glass might be classified into three key types: deal with plates for flat-panel photo voltaic cells, generally crafted from rolled glass; slender-film solar cell conductive substrates, coated with semiconductor materials commonly just a couple micrometers thick over the floor of flat glass; and glass lenses or reflectors used in concentrating photovoltaic techniques.
